Ayton and Eyemouth
About This Route
An interesting circular including a section of the Berwickshire Coastal Path and an Old Post Road that leads you to the attractive settlement of Ayton. You will pass an old mill by the Eye Water, a river that powered 13 corn mills, 2 textile mills and 1 paper mill. The number of corn mills is indicative of the fact that arable farming is common in Berwickshire.
